What Sostiene Pereira is like to read

A quiet, morally weighted portrait of a middle-aged journalist edging toward resistance under Salazar's Portugal — interior and politically charged rather than plot-driven. Best for: readers who want intimate political-conscience novels set in 20th-century European dictatorships.
